본문 바로가기

소프트웨어

파이썬 matplotlib 에서 3d view 카메라 위치 선정 방법

    from mpl_toolkits.mplot3d import Axes3D
    ax = Axes3D(fig)
    ax.scatter(xx,yy,zz, marker='o', s=20, c="goldenrod", alpha=0.6)
    for ii in xrange(0,360,1):
        ax.view_init(elev=10., azim=ii)
        savefig("movie%d.png" % ii)

다음과같이 ax.view_init을 사용하면 카메라의 각도를 선정할 수 있으며 imagio와 같은 툴을 사용하면 for문과 함께 gif로도 나타낼 수 있다.